Application Scenario:
In a simple project, MSP430F2131TDGVR can be used to create a temperature monitoring system, where it reads data from a temperature sensor and displays it on an LCD screen.
Circuit Design:
To implement the temperature monitoring system using MSP430F2131TDGVR, follow these steps:
1. Temperature Sensor Connection:
Connect a temperature sensor, such as a TMP36 or LM35, to one of the analog input pins of MSP430F2131TDGVR, such as pin P1.0. Ensure appropriate signal conditioning, like using a voltage divider circuit if necessary.
2. LCD Display:
Connect an LCD display module to MSP430F2131TDGVR for visualizing the temperature readings. Utilize GPIO pins, such as P2.0 to P2.7, for data and control signals.
3. Programming:
Write firmware code to configure the ADC (Analog-to-Digital Converter) module of MSP430F2131TDGVR to read analog data from the temperature sensor. Convert the ADC readings into temperature values using appropriate conversion formulas.
4. Display:
Write code to display the temperature readings on the LCD screen. Implement functions to update the display periodically with new temperature data.
5. Power Management:
Optimize power management to ensure efficient operation and prolong battery life if applicable. Utilize low-power modes of MSP430F2131TDGVR when the system is idle.
Experiment Steps:
Step 1: Connect the temperature sensor to pin P1.0 of MSP430F2131TDGVR using jumper wires.
Step 2: Connect the LCD display module to GPIO pins P2.0 to P2.7 of MSP430F2131TDGVR according to the datasheet of the display module.
Step 3: Write firmware code in an integrated development environment (IDE) such as Code Composer Studio or Energia to configure the ADC and read temperature data from the sensor.
Step 4: Implement code to display the temperature readings on the LCD screen. Test the system by varying the temperature around the sensor.
Step 5: Optimize the firmware code for power efficiency, ensuring that the system consumes minimal power during operation.
Considerations:
When designing and implementing the project, consider the following:
- Accuracy of temperature readings: Calibrate the temperature sensor if necessary to ensure accurate readings.
- Display readability: Choose an appropriate LCD display module with adequate resolution and contrast for clear temperature display.
- Power consumption: Optimize the firmware and hardware design to minimize power consumption and maximize battery life if the system is battery-powered.
- User interface: Design a user-friendly interface for displaying temperature readings and any additional information.
- System reliability: Test the system thoroughly to ensure its reliability and stability under various operating conditions.
